EnerSys is the global leader in stored energy solutions for industrial applications. We have over thirty manufacturing and assembly plants worldwide servicing over 10,000 customers in more than 100 countries. Worldwide headquarters are located in Reading, PA, USA with regional headquarters in Europe and Asia. We complement our extensive line of Motive Power and Energy Systems with a full range of integrated services and systems. With sales and service locations throughout the world, and over 100 years of battery experience, EnerSys is the power/full solution for stored DC power products.
Job Purpose
The Engineering Manager is responsible for the successful delivery of the Engineering and technical function aligned with the business vision, mission and objectives. They are a critical part of the leadership team and form the lynchpin for successful transformational change through leadership of a multi skilled Engineering department consisting of highly trained Project Engineers, CAD Engineers and Li-Ion cell Engineers for space flight.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ities
- Leadership and goal setting for the department
- Delivery to the business of revenue generating hours
- Monitoring internal department project hours/schedule/cost adherence
- Reviewing and agreeing project priority (internally to department, and at business level)
- Timely delivery of cells to projects
- Verification of product as flight suitable through test and analysis
- Ensuring Technical inputs to projects (internal and external) are of sufficient quality
- Developing and implementing department cost reduction and improvement strategy
- Communication of department information within the business
- Defining, tracking and reporting department KPIs
- Defining and maintaining the department process document system
- Audit preparation and participation
